Grenfell cladding firm a ‘significant source of revenue’ for BRE, inquiry told

grenfell (2)

Hearing sees emails from BRE consultant saying desktop studies of Grenfell insulation could be ‘huge source of income’

The BRE received a “significant source of revenue” by producing desktop studies for combustible Kingspan insulation used on Grenfell Tower, the inquiry has heard.

Tom Lennon, a consultant at BRE, a testing body, claimed the studies could be a “huge source of income” for the BRE in a 2015 email.

Desktop studies take the results of full-scale fire tests on cladding systems and model variations to the specification to demonstrate equivalent fire performance.
